Abstract

A relatively small liquid-crystal display (LCD) device located well above the fresnel stage of an overhead projector produces large, sharp images with full color and motion. A focus-correcting lens moves with the overhead projector's optical head to maintain proper projection-focus and magnification. Spectrally-selective filters are interposed between the LCD device and fresnel stage to avoid LCD deterioration. A fan-actuated shutter or electrically-actuated shutter optionally provide still further protection. Optical collimation methods are employed to attain a large depth-of-field and image brightness.
